Lorraine T. Pilling (nee Schell) lovingly known as “Lori”, of Philadelphia, formerly of Southwest Philadelphia passed away peacefully surrounded by the love of her family on June 21, 2026.
Lori was the beloved daughter of the late Joseph & Helen Schell; devoted wife of Rich Pilling; loving mother of Lorraine Jackson; and adoring Mommom of Noah and Avery.
She is also survived by her loving siblings: Joseph Schell, Frederick “Freddy” Schell (Regina), Helen “Lynnie” Dougherty (the late Thomas), and Veronica “Vicky” Schell (the late Philip). Lori was cherished by her many nieces and nephews, all of whom held a special place in her heart.
Lori found joy in life’s simple pleasures, watching classic television with her beloved husband, sharing laughter with family and friends, and spending time being silly with her grandchildren.
Known as the life of the party, Lori had a gift of bringing laughter and happiness wherever she went. Her kind and generous spirit made everyone feel loved, welcomed and appreciated. She leaves behind a legacy of warmth, humor, and unconditional love that will be remembered and cherished by all who knew her.
